Friday, March 12, 2010. Inspiring Teachers- Who inspires you? Dee McLellan graduated from the University of Minnesota with aspirations of being an effective teacher. Like many students interested in teaching as a career, Dee was originally inspired by a teacher who taught her in the fifth grade. Thursday, March 25, 2010. CBS People: Eileen Furlong. Senior Lab Services Coordinator. Number of years with the college:. Biology Program, St. Paul Labs. Describe something interesting or unusual about your work here:. I work with the animal behavior teaching lab and get to work with a lot of fish, insects, and other arthropods. I came back after winter break to find one of the wolf spiders had had babies while I was gone. She was carrying a teaming mass of little spiderlings on her back! Plus, a planned...
